The cheapest way to get from Lowell to Deer Island is to drive which costs $5 - $9 and takes 49 min.
The fastest way to get from Lowell to Deer Island is to drive which takes 49 min and costs $5 - $9.
No, there is no direct bus from Lowell to Deer Island. However, there are services departing from Robert B Kennedy Bus Transfer Center and arriving at Deer Island - MWRA Gate via South Station and Orient Heights.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 56m.
No, there is no direct train from Lowell to Deer Island. However, there are services departing from Lowell and arriving at Orient Heights via Bowdoin.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 23m.
The distance between Lowell and Deer Island is 31 miles. The road distance is 31.4 miles.
The best way to get from Lowell to Deer Island without a car is to train which takes 1h 23m and costs $8 - $19.
It takes approximately 1h 23m to get from Lowell to Deer Island, including transfers.
Lowell to Deer Island bus services, operated by Greyhound USA, depart from Robert B Kennedy Bus Transfer Center station.
Lowell to Deer Island train services, operated by MBTA, depart from Lowell station.
The best way to get from Lowell to Deer Island is to train which takes 1h 23m and costs $8 - $19. Alternatively, you can bus and line 713 bus, which costs $23 - $40 and takes 1h 56m.
